Форум программистов, компьютерный форум CyberForum.ru

Обьявление переменных в циклах и до -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Простейший калькулятор http://www.cyberforum.ru/cpp-beginners/thread174275.html
Калькулятор считает сумму, разность, произведение и частное двух чисел a и b Код: #include <stdio.h> #include <conio.h> int main() { float a,b; char ch;
C++ Подсчет времени выполнения сортировки Подскажите, пожалуйста, как написать в программе, чтобы подсчитывало время выполнения сортировки? Там как-то надо ввести "clock time" с нетерпением жду ответа)) http://www.cyberforum.ru/cpp-beginners/thread174268.html
Пропишите, пожалуйста каждую строчку, а то я объясняю преподавателю, а он говорит что не правильно( C++
#include <cstdlib> #include <iostream> #include <Windows.h> using namespace std; int main(int argc, char *argv) {const int n=10; double mas; int i, t, start,stop;
комбинаторика C++
Здравствуйте! Я решаю задачи по дискретной математике на языке С.В интернете масса примеров задач на тему комбинаторики, но на языке паскаль (но я его вообще НЕ проходила) пожалуйста, помогите спереводом задачи (с синтаксисом языка вообще не знакома ни со школы ни с универа) Напишите программу, которая осуществляет перечисление всех (n, r) сочетаний без повторений. С=n!/(r!(n-r)!)...
C++ Ошибка при виводе http://www.cyberforum.ru/cpp-beginners/thread174245.html
незнаю что ет за ошибка...но помогите исправить #include<iostream> #include<fstream> #include<string> #include<algorithm> #include<vector> #include<list> using namespace std; class Prices{
C++ C++ тест здравствуйте,извините за беспокойство.нужно написать программу-тест на с++,вопрос вот в чем: как сделать так,чтобы вопросы в тесте появлялись в случайном порядке (10 вопросов,5 вариантов ответов). подробнее

Показать сообщение отдельно
kravam
быдлокодер
 Аватар для kravam
1512 / 872 / 44
Регистрация: 04.06.2008
Сообщений: 5,267
09.10.2010, 20:15     Обьявление переменных в циклах и до
Парень, всё дело в том, что ты объявляешь переменнную x в цикле, что допустимо. И видна эта переменная будет ИСКЛЮЧИТЕЛЬНО в этом цикле, то естЬ от одной фигурной скобки до другой, от { до }

Строчка
C++
1
cout<< endl<< Цикл прерван при x= "<< x<< endl;
Находится ВНЕ этого цикла. Поэтому и возникает ошибка

На мой взгляд, самое оптимальное решение проблемы, объявить x вне цикла
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
#include <iostream>
#include <iomanip>
#include <math.h>
using namespace std;
 
int main () {
 int x;
 for (x= 1; x<= 6; x++) {
  if (x== 5)
   break;
   cout<< x<< " ";
 }
 cout<< endl<< "Цикл прерван при x="<< x<< endl;
 return 0;
}
 
Текущее время: 17:26.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ru